AbbVie receives EC approval for VENCLYXTO label expansion
AFBytes Brief
AbbVie received European Commission authorization for an expanded label on VENCLYXTO. The decision broadens approved uses of the therapy.
Why this matters
Expanded regulatory approval can affect treatment options and revenue streams for pharmaceutical companies operating in Europe.
